Rancho Niguel, Laguna Niguel, CA Local Guide

How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Rancho Niguel?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
Rancho Niguel Studio Apartments | $2,570 | $2,250 | $2,860 |
| Rancho Niguel 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,869 | $2,295 | $4,841 |
| Rancho Niguel 2 Bedroom Apartments | $3,487 | $2,385 | $4,869 |
| Rancho Niguel 3 Bedroom Apartments | $4,375 | $3,710 | $5,260 |

What Are Walk Score®, Transit Score®, and Bike Score® Ratings?
- Walk Score® measures the walkability of any address.
- Transit Score® measures access to public transit.
- Bike Score® measures the bikeability of any address.
